Today, Buckingham Palace announced via Queen Elizabeth’s @theroyalfamily Instagram account that her granddaughter Princess Beatrice is officially engaged to real estate mogul Edoardo Mapelli Mozzi.

The palace released a series of engagement photographs of the happy couple captured by Princess Beatrice’s younger sister, Princess Eugenie, in Italy. In the series of portraits, the 31-year-old bride-to-be is wearing a gorgeous floral Zimmermann dress that’s not yet sold out.

Zimmermann is a favorite of Princess Beatrice, so it seems fitting she selected the Allia floral-print linen maxi dress for her special occasion. The flowy frock features puffed balloon sleeves (a royal favorite), a fitted bodice and a fresh floral print. Beatrice’s emerald ensemble will run you a cool $695, but at least it’s a great transitional piece that works just as well for an engagement as it does as a wedding guest dress.

The princess accessorized her engagement portrait dress with her brand-new 3.5 carat ring, which her 34-year-old fiancé designed himself, and her go-to Cartier Juste un clou gold bracelet ($3,050).

According to Buckingham Palace’s post, the couple became engaged in Italy earlier this month after dating less than a year. They plan to hold their wedding in 2020, location TBD.

Princess Beatrice and Mapelli Mozzi released a joint statement saying, “We are extremely happy to be able to share the news of our recent engagement. We are both so excited to be embarking on this life adventure together and can’t wait to be married. We share so many similar interests and values and we know this will stand us in great stead for the years ahead, full of love and happiness.”
